Tape offers an extensive line of single coated film tapes with a variety of film backings and adhesive systems. Our polyester-silicone tapes are used for splicing silicone coated papers and high temperature masking applications. We offer these in different colors and different thickness’ depending on your application needs. We also offer polyester-acrylic tapes, polyimide-silicone, polyester-acrylic and polyethylene-rubber. All of these products can be procesed in long length machine rolls for continuous processing. We also offer these tapes die-cut in different designs and configurations. High voltage self-fusing rubber tape is an essential tool in electrical insulation and repair tasks. This specialized tape is designed to provide excellent electrical insulation, moisture resistance, and mechanical protection in high-voltage applications.
